Output 858169095027438866e1108431bb767b130c361488923569501943a65f9e4e3d:0

value
35490
script pubkey
OP_0 OP_PUSHBYTES_20 1b2a3cd00e7d83bcbff825276723c035d3408aa5
address
bc1qrv4re5qw0kpme0lcy5nkwg7qxhf5pz49ly07qp
transaction
858169095027438866e1108431bb767b130c361488923569501943a65f9e4e3d